What Is a French Door?
French doors are characterized by their Double French Door Repairs-leaf building and construction, usually including big panes of glass set within a wooden frame. They serve both aesthetic and practical purposes, enabling natural light to flood into a room while providing an unblocked view of the outdoors. Coming from in France during the Renaissance, these doors have progressed however still preserve their traditional appeal.

When looking for a skilled carpenter for your French door project, keep these consider mind:
1. Experience and Expertise
Look for carpenters who concentrate on French doors. Their experience will reflect in the quality of their work and ability to manage specific difficulties associated with the installation.
2. Portfolio of Work
Request to see a portfolio showcasing their previous French door tasks. This will offer you a concept of their style and workmanship.
3. Referrals and Reviews
Reading evaluations and requesting for references from previous clients can assist assess the carpenter's dependability and professionalism.
4. Licensing and Insurance
Ensure that the carpenter is accredited and guaranteed. This safeguards both celebrations in case of accidents or damage throughout the installation procedure.
5. Material Knowledge
A great French door carpenter should be experienced about various products (like wood, fiberglass, or aluminum) and their particular advantages and disadvantages.
6. Service warranty and Aftercare
Inquire if the carpenter uses any guarantees on their work and what aftercare services they supply.

Q2: Are French doors energy-efficient?
A: Yes, modern-day French doors are readily available with energy-efficient features, including double-glazed glass and insulated frames.
Q3: How long does the installation procedure take?
A: Installation generally takes a few hours to a day, depending upon the complexity of the job and any required adjustments to the existing frame.
Q4: Can French doors be installed in locations besides exterior walls?
A: Absolutely! French doors can also be used as interior doors, providing a sophisticated transition in between rooms.
Q5: How can I keep my French doors?
A: Regular cleaning, examining hardware for wear, and guaranteeing seals are intact will assist maintain the beauty and performance of your French doors.
